Class Summary- Lateral Entry Level Position
- Only Current Certified Firefighter/EMT Candidates
Employees must successfully complete state EMS licensure, state firefighter certification, and other requirements to operate on a department emergency response vehicle during the first two years of employment.
Applicants must pass a comprehensive background investigation including criminal, controlled substance, driving, employment history checks, an oral interview, medical exam including drug screen, psychological and physical agility testing.
Minimum Qualifications- High School Diploma, or G.E.D. certificate (copy must be attached to application)
- Valid Driver's License from state of residency equivalent to GA Class C or higher
- Must be at least 18 years of age
- Must be currently a Certified Firefighter/EMT
Minimum Qualifications
- Current National Registry () or State of Georgia EMT certification OR higher
- State of GA NPQ Firefighter I and/or Firefighter II
- NPQ Hazmat Awareness
- NPQ Hazmat Operations
Job Requirements
This job is a safety sensitive position that will require a pre‑employment drug test and subsequent random drug and alcohol testing.
This job requires a public safety background check to include motor vehicle histories, criminal histories, and fingerprinting.
This job may require on‑call rotation and emergency after‑hours, weekends, and/or holidays.
Lateral Entry Firefighter/EMT- $49,086 - $78,589 (Starting Salary without a degree)
- $50,558 - $80,946 (Starting Salary including 3% incentive for an associate degree)
- $52,031 - $83,304 (Starting Salary including 6% incentive for a bachelor's degree)
The grade for this position is FF213.
